Features at a Glance

Key components: Built-in design, digital controls, multiple cooking modes, self-cleaning option, and a large capacity oven.

FeatureDescription
Self-CleaningAutomated cleaning cycle for easy maintenance
Convection CookingEven cooking with a fan that circulates hot air
Digital ControlsEasy-to-use interface for precise temperature settings
Large CapacitySpacious interior for cooking multiple dishes
Delay StartProgram cooking to start at a later time
Temperature ProbeMonitor internal temperature of dishes

Cooking Modes

The KitchenAid KEBC177K offers various cooking modes for versatility:

  1. Bake: Ideal for cakes, cookies, and casseroles.
  2. Broil: Perfect for meats and browning.
  3. Convection: Even cooking with hot air circulation.
  4. Self-Clean: Automated cleaning cycle for easy maintenance.

WARNING! Always monitor food while cooking to prevent burning.

Troubleshooting

SymptomPossible CauseCorrective Action
Oven not heatingPower supply issueCheck circuit breaker and power connections.
Control panel unresponsivePower interruptionReset the oven by unplugging and plugging back in.
Uneven cookingIncorrect rack positionAdjust rack position for optimal heat distribution.
Self-cleaning not startingDoor not closedEnsure the oven door is securely closed.
